Abstract:

Even though the interconnected subsystems of a class of nonlinear systems are controlled by the same sampling period, it is common that the sampled-data time instant of each subsystem is different. In this case, the problem of using sampled-data output feedback to design global decentralized stabilizers for the decentralized systems is quite challenging but also interesting. To solve this problem, in this paper we propose a methodology to construct a set of decentralized stabilizers, which are implemented using the unsynchronized sampling instants.
